九、多线程爬虫9.1利用多线程爬虫爬取糗事百科的资源:         十、爬虫代码总结:       要实现一个完整的爬虫,无外乎4个核心步骤:       1.首先我们要确定要爬取的目标url:    &n
转载 2023-07-09 12:22:15
67阅读
作者周云猛启大家好,我是新来的小编小周。今天给大家带来的是python爬虫入门,文章以简为要,引导初学者快速上手爬虫。话不多说,我们开始今天的内容。在初步学习爬虫之前,我们先用一个例子来看看爬虫是什么。A同学想要了解python是一种怎样的语言,于是打开了某度搜索引擎,却发现占据屏幕的是各类python学习课程的广告,而真正介绍python的内容却被放在了后面。事实上,在大多数时候,我们用浏览器获
高级语言的执行方式 分为两种:一种是编译执行,即程序编写完成后直接将其编译为机器语言后执行。另一种是解释执行,即程序一边解释一边运行。比如,C语言采取的是编译执行方式,而Python语言采取解释执行的方式。第1章 编程与Python第2章 Python起步第3章 Python数据类型 转义符相关3.字符串处理函数>>> mystr = 'Beautiful is better t
转载 2023-10-16 23:27:41
44阅读
# 如何搞定Python分布式爬虫课程 ## 一、整体流程 首先,让我们来看一下完成“21搞定Python分布式爬虫课程”的整体流程。我们可以用下面的表格来展示每一步的具体操作: | 步骤 | 操作 | 代码示例
原创 2024-04-21 03:25:30
16阅读
小目标:掌握列表相关知识点主要内容:列表添加,删除,遍历如果看完这篇文章,你还是弄不明白列表相关方法;你来找我,我保证不打你,我给你发100的大红包。1.列表基础列表形式:[item1, item2,....itemN];列表是序列一种,支持序列通用操作列表中的元素可以是任意对象,可以理解为容器;1.1 创建列表直接定义列表:#数字列表list1 = [1,2,3,4]#字符串列表list2 =
Python学习网络爬虫主要分3个大的版块:抓取,分析,存储当我们在浏览器中输入一个url后回车,后台会发生什么?简单来说这段过程发生了以下四个步骤:网络爬虫要做的,简单来说,就是实现浏览器的功能。通过指定url,直接返回给用户所需要的数据,而不需要一步步人工去操纵浏览器获取。所以想学的同学,有必要听一下这位老师的课、领取python福利奥,想学的同学可以到梦雅老师的围鑫(同音):前排的是:762
# Python 21:掌握编程的入门之路 Python是一种简单易学的编程语言,它在数据科学、人工智能及Web开发等领域有着广泛应用。为帮助初学者快速入门,本文基于“Python 21”的学习计划,为你提供相关的代码示例和学习建议。 ## 第1:环境搭建 在学习Python之前,我们需要安装Python和一个适合的IDE(集成开发环境)。推荐使用PyCharm或VSCode。这些工具
原创 10月前
10阅读
作者:IDO老徐简尚 开始之前的,前置准备事项:1、在自己电脑上安装一个mysql数据库,文章见 ->http://istester.com/article/258.html2、找一个mysql客户端链接工具:推荐workbench  ,安装包 http://istester.com/article/405.html  第1作业&nbsp
转载 2023-11-18 21:42:37
80阅读
XPath轴轴定义了当前节点和所选节点的树关系,绝对路径,以正斜杠开始(/),例如/step1/step2/……相对路径,不以正斜杠开始(/),例如step/step2/……步(step)的语法:轴(axis)::节点测试(node-test)[谓语]谓语是零个或者多个。 轴名称含义child选取当前节点的所有子元素parent选取当前节点的父节点ancestor选取当前节点的所有先辈a
原创 2024-09-15 22:19:31
40阅读
image.png《21学通Python》完整版PDF提取码:xa0yimage.png书中的推荐学习计划第1python的特点Windows下和Linux下安装Python的流程编译和运行Python程序第2Python的基础语法Python最简单的键盘输入与屏幕输出用Python进行算式的计算第3Python的简单数据类型Python结构数据类型内置常量与逻辑运算符、比较运算符序列的使
有三种方式可以运行Python:1、交互式解释器:你可以通过命令行窗口进入 Python,并在交互式解释器中开始编写 Python 代码。你可以在 Unix、DOS 或任何其他提供了命令行或者 shell 的系统进行 Python 编码工作。$ python # Unix/Linux或者C:>python # Windows/DOS以下为Python命令行参数:选项描述-d在解析时显示调试信
原创 2023-04-08 17:12:26
179阅读
21学通Python全面、系统、深入地讲解了Python编程基础语法与高级应用。在讲解过程中,通过大量实际操作的实例将Python语言知识全面、系统、深入地呈现给读者。此外,作者专门为本书录制了大量的配套教学视频,让读者通过分析实例、运行实例尽快熟悉Python编程,在学习中遇到问题时,也可以作为参考。本书共分三篇。第一篇介绍Python语言的特点、安装、语法基础、程序流程控制、面向过程的编程方
转载 2023-08-16 11:41:33
110阅读
# 21学会Python:入门到精通的快速通道 Python是一种高层次的编程语言,以其简洁的语法和强大的功能而受到广大开发者的青睐。在本篇文章中,我们将介绍“21学会Python”的学习计划,带你快速掌握Python的基本知识,并通过代码示例加深理解。 ## 学习计划概述 在接下来的21里,我们将通过以下内容来学习Python: 1. Python基础语法 2. 数据结构与算法 3
昨天,刷知乎。我大概明白为何我总有那么多的迷茫。也明白为何我那么讨厌别人讲人生是一个过程,明白为何同学对讲
原创 2022-12-12 17:15:12
272阅读
如果输出中文字符 "你好,世界" Python有可能会碰到中文编码问题。Python 文件中如果未指定编码,在执行过程会出现报错:#!/usr/bin/python print ("你好,世界")以上程序执行输出结果为:File "test.py", line 2 SyntaxError: Non-ASCII character '\xe4' in file test.py
原创 2023-04-09 14:29:21
117阅读
Python学习中很重要的一部分就是Python爬虫,同时它
原创 2023-07-12 20:27:46
49阅读
今天我们来谈一谈,怎样学Python,才不会从入门到完全放弃 20教你学会Python,《20学通Python》pdf拿走不谢,堪称经典有位叫骆昊 (jackfrued) 的资深程序员,为大家规划了一条从“从新手到大神”的100从全方位熟悉语言,到Python的进阶用法,再到天南地北的实战攻略:只要沿着这条路走下去,就都会遇到的。 20教你学会Python,《20
一、爬虫的步骤1、 需求分析(人做) 2、寻找网站(人) 3、下载网站的返回内容(requests) 4、通过返回的信息找到需要爬取的数据内容(正则表达式-re,xpath-lxml) 5、存储找到的数据内容(mysql)二、requestsimport requests url = 'http://www.baidu.com/' response = requests.get(url) prin
转载 2023-08-14 23:46:58
717阅读
从零开始爬的虫前言一、前情提要1.基础知识2.html基础3.网页操作4.AJAX5.请求和响应6.cookie和session7.线程和进程8.代理ip9.超级鹰二、通用爬虫1.案例三、聚焦爬虫1.数据解析2.方法3.xpath4.案例四、增量爬虫五、异步爬虫1.方式2.线程池3.协程六、selenium1.什么是selenium2.基本使用3.案例七、奇奇怪怪的知识点1.正则快速加引号2.提
转载 2023-09-18 21:00:13
107阅读
 声明:在人工智能技术教学期间,不少学生向我提一些python相关的问题,所以为了让同学们掌握更多扩展知识更好的理解人工智能技术,我让助理负责分享这套python系列教程,希望能帮到大家! 从系统命令行开始运行程序文件是相当直接明了的选择,特别是在通过你之前的日常工作已熟悉了命令行的使用时。对于初学者来说,我们提示大家注意这些新手陷阱: •注意Windows上的默认扩
原创 2022-08-12 16:52:37
74阅读
  • 1
  • 2
  • 3
  • 4
  • 5